Welcome to the panel discussion hosted by Pento and Figures where we'll discuss all things compensation!

If you work at a startup or a scale-up, you're well aware of the current macro-climate and the worries that come with it. Teams across industries have changed their growth strategy and are getting more conscious about their #1 operating cost - employee compensation. At the same time, inflation and cost of living are pushing salary expectations of employees upward and sometimes even lead to companies introducing one-off bonuses.

So let's get specific - what should your compensation strategy look like? What do you have to take into account? How do other companies approach it? How do you introduce it to your team? To help you answer all these questions, we're bringing together the strongest forces in the industry who will share their insights, knowledge, and experience around building and implementing a successful compensation strategy!
